WebSat allows one to submit his/her sequences, visualise microsatellites, design primers suitable for their amplification, and export the resulting data, thus facilitating the development of SSR markers.
Tandem mass spectral peptide identification and validation software, similar to X!Tandem, OMSSA, MyriMatch. Suitable for single hosts through large clusters. Written in Python for simplicity, with performance-critical sections in C++.

This project implements an algorithm for segmenting protein sequences into smaller meaningful blocks. The method is based on the pure statistical approach and it uses an analogy between proteins and natural language.
A small java API library for running the MM3 molecular mechanics package from within a java environment. It does not include MM3, nor implement MM3. The MM3 binaries have to be available on the user system.

The Antigen Variability ANAlyzer (AVANA) tool uses information entropy to measure variability in protein sequence alignments. It also compares alignments using mutual information, identifying the mutations that characterize specific sequence sets.

CILib is a framework for developing Computational Intelligence software in swarm intelligence, evolutionary computing, neural networks, artificial immune systems, fuzzy logic and robotics.
IMP is an automated tool for intron-flanking primer design based off of Expressed Sequence Tags (ESTs). It's intended for use in species with limited to no genomic sequence data available.
NGSView is a generally applicable, flexible and extensible next-generation sequence alignment editor. The software allows for visualization and manipulation of millions of sequences simultaneously on a desktop computer, through a graphical interface.
